> > I haven't tried it myself, but just looking at what the patch changed I
> > would edit the mythtv/libs/libmyth/mythmedia.cpp file and add the
> > following code before the VERBOSE in the if (len < 0) condition after
> > the readlink:
> >
> > if (errno != 2 && errno != 22)
> >
> > So the section would now look like:
> >
> > ssize_t len = readlink(DeviceName.local8Bit(), lpath, PATH_MAX);
> > if (len < 0)
> > {
> >   if (errno != ENOENT && errno != EINVAL)
> >     VERBOSE(VB_IMPORTANT, LOC_ERR + "readlink() failed: " + ENO);
> >   continue;
> > }
> >
> > I would imagine ENOENT and EINVAL could be normal returns if it is
> > checking directories that don't exist or are the wrong type.
> >
> > Copying to the dev list as it is related to SVN.
